On 02/09/2012 11:09 AM, David A Case wrote:
> On Thu, Feb 09, 2012, Andreas Goetz wrote:
>> On my openSuSE 12.1 box, two directories are created for libraries,
>> $AMBERHOME/lib
>> $AMBERHOME/lib64
> This seems unique to openSuSE (maybe other distros). It seems to be created
> by the fftw3 configure(?) What is in $AMBERHOME/lib64?
>
> This lib vs lib64 stuff is a real pain. It seems like the simplest solution
> is just to have the configure2 script create a soft-link pointer that makes
> $AMBERHOME/lib64 point to $AMBERHOME/lib. Then things put into the first will
> be visible in the second.
>

I've explicitly set the FFTW library directory to be $AMBERHOME/lib at
configure time and pushed the change. Let me know if this solves the
problem.
